Maybank Avenue is in Wembley and in Brent district. HA0 2TH is located in the Sudbury elect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Brent North.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Maybank Avenue was 52.1 per 1,000 residents, which is 0.1% lower than the Northwick Park average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Maybank Avenue has the 19th lowest crime rate of 42 local areas in Northwick Park and the 243rd lowest crime rate of 811 local areas in Brent .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 30.9 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-22.9%.
